Weird Facts about Wyoming
October 24th, 2005· Wyoming was the first state in the US to offer suffrage to women. Why? They needed the women’s votes to get enough votes to become a state. Wyoming also had the first woman governor in the US, Nellie Ross in 1925 and the first female court bailiff and the first woman justice of the peace.
· Black Thunder is a Wyoming coal mine and the largest in the US. It is located very close to Wright, Wyoming.
· If you study Wyoming’s flag, you will see the buffalo has a seal on it. Why? The seal actually represents a brand, which is a custom of identifying livestock.
· The state sport of Wyoming is the Rodeo. The state dinosaur is a Triceratops and the state coin is the Golden Dollar.
· Wyoming is also known as the Cowboy State and Big Wonderful Wyoming.
· In 1892, the Johnson County War, a skirmish between free roaming agents and cattlemen took place.
· In 2003, wolves killed only 15 sheep in Wyoming. Eagles killed 150. Still, the wolf is known for being hostile toward ranchers and is hunted yearly.
· Water that flows through the Continental Divide and into Wyoming’s Great Divide Basin doesn’t flow into an ocean or any large body of water. It soaks into the ground or is evaporated by the sun because the state is so arid.
